CLEP Educational Psychology Practice Test Q&A
Who would be less likely to explore gender-typed toys of the opposite gender? - correct answer Boys- less likely to stray from toys directed to their gender
Which of the following is true of the confluence model of development? - correct answer Multiple family variables combine to produce important influences on a child's development
Confluence model - correct answer Suggests there is no isolated variable that produces the greatest effect on a childs development, according to the model multiple variables flow together to shape the development
According to Freudian psychology, which aspect of our personality are developed over time? - correct answer Ego and Superego- develop in response to the id, as a result of awareness and social conditioning
The id - correct answer Part of our personality that is present at birth and contains basic urges
Which relationship exists between physical abuse and physcial neglect? - correct answer Physical neglect causes more deaths than physical abuse because it could lead to starvation, failure to thrive, and other conditions that result in death
What is not true about pretend play among children? - correct answer That it is more common among groups of girls than boys. Pretend play involves much language and thought and serves an extremely useful function for cognitive development. Gender of the child doesn't seem to have an impact on the ability or desire to play pretend
Albert Bandura suggests girls with high self efficiency are more likely to: - correct answer Select non-traditional careers; because high self efficacy (the perceived ability to succeed at tasks) is linked to the selection of non traditional and challenging careers.
